Protocol v26 is viewed by many community members as a potential gateway to the next stage of Pi Network’s development. The introduction of advanced blockchain functionality could significantly expand the ecosystem by allowing developers to build more sophisticated applications and financial services.
One of the most anticipated features connected to this vision is decentralized exchange technology, commonly known as DEX.
A decentralized exchange allows users to trade digital assets directly through blockchain-based systems without depending on centralized intermediaries. Unlike traditional exchanges that control user accounts and transactions, DEX platforms rely on smart contracts to automate trading processes.
If integrated into the Pi Network ecosystem, decentralized exchange functionality could create new opportunities for Pi Coin and ecosystem tokens.
Users could potentially exchange digital assets within the network, while developers could build applications that rely on decentralized financial infrastructure.
Another major component expected from future blockchain expansion is smart contract functionality.
Smart contracts are self-executing programs stored on a blockchain that automatically perform actions when predefined conditions are met. They serve as the foundation for many decentralized applications, including financial platforms, marketplaces, gaming systems, and digital ownership solutions.
The introduction of smart contracts could significantly expand what developers are able to create within Pi Network.
Instead of focusing only on transactions, the ecosystem could support a wide range of decentralized services powered by programmable blockchain technology.
Launchpad platforms are another feature frequently mentioned in discussions surrounding the future of Pi Network.
A launchpad allows new blockchain projects to introduce their tokens or applications to the community through structured fundraising and development processes. Within a growing ecosystem, launchpads can help connect developers with users while encouraging innovation.
If implemented responsibly, such platforms could support the creation of new businesses and applications within the Pi Network environment.

However, the introduction of these advanced features also brings additional challenges.
The cryptocurrency industry continues facing increasing regulatory attention worldwide. Governments and financial authorities are developing new frameworks to address digital assets, decentralized finance, and blockchain-based financial services.
For large-scale blockchain projects, regulatory compliance has become a critical factor in long-term sustainability.
Community discussions have highlighted the importance of regulatory clarity, including developments such as the U.S. CLARITY Act, which aims to establish clearer rules regarding digital assets and blockchain markets.
Although regulatory environments continue evolving, many blockchain projects are carefully considering how future features can operate within legal frameworks.
For Pi Network, waiting for greater regulatory certainty could be viewed as a strategic decision rather than a delay.
Launching decentralized financial features too early without clear compliance considerations could expose a blockchain ecosystem to unnecessary legal challenges.
By taking additional time for testing and preparation, the project may be attempting to reduce risks while creating a more sustainable foundation.
